September 28, 2023 By Trent Shupe 3 min read

Modern application environments need real-time automated observability to have visibility and insights into what is going on. Because of the highly dynamic nature of microservices and the numerous interdependencies among application components, having an automated approach to observability is essential. That’s why traditional solutions like New Relic struggle to keep up with monitoring in cloud-native environments. 

Automation in observability is a requirement

When an application is not performing properly, customers are unhappy and your business can suffer. If your observability platform relies on manual instrumentation or configuration, you will undoubtedly suffer the consequences of slower resolution of incidents, visibility gaps and a lack of understanding of your application environments.  That’s why automation is an essential component of any observability solution.

Installation and setup are crucial components of any modern, automated observability platform. If you are a New Relic user, you know that it requires manual instrumentation and configuration. In fact, New Relic requires you to deploy a custom “application” to facilitate the full use of their analytics tool. New Relic users must change the configuration files and update the code, depending on the technology being monitored.  New Relic also uses different agents for different technologies and requires multiple agents per host. All of this requires manual effort and takes considerable time and resources to install, set up and continuously maintain New Relic monitoring. 

When you have to manually configure instrumentation, chances are you’ll leave visibility gaps because you can’t possibly know all the interdependencies between application services and infrastructure components. Further, manually configuring any of those connections and relationships requires time and resources. To handle modern applications and higher velocity development processes, you need a solution that maximizes visibility with the least amount of effort.  

Automate installation and setup

Contrast that with IBM Instana’s automated, single-agent architecture that makes installation and setup a breeze. There’s no guessing which agent(s) need to be installed on which hosts. There’s no need to manually identify and configure interdependencies. Instana does all of that for you—automatically. It saves you time and effort and helps accelerate the CI/CD pipeline.

Instana goes even further to automate everything

IBM Instana automates every aspect of the performance monitoring lifecycle. It automates installation and configuration. It automates application discovery. It automates dashboards. It automates profiling. It automates alerts, troubleshooting and change detection.  

Does your current observability solution automate all of those things? If not, you need to consider IBM Instana. 

IBM Instana not only captures every performance metric in real-time, it automates tracing every single user request and profiles every process. It combines the data from metrics, traces, events and profiles, making it available (in context) to the people who need it. So when a problem occurs, Instana automatically identifies the slowest service or component of the causal event. And with one-second metric granularity, Instana can detect issues that others, including New Relic, might miss. 

For troubleshooting in complex environments, automated root-cause analysis is a requirement. Instana streamlines the troubleshooting process by employing machine learning algorithms, anomaly detection techniques and predictive analytics to automatically identify potential trouble patterns that would likely be missed by human operators. By automating the analysis work, Instana can reduce the time required to identify the root cause of an incident and improve the accuracy of detection, leading to faster resolution. 

IBM Instana even automates remediation actions with the Instana Action Catalog™, allowing you to build custom actions or reuse existing automation inventories like Ansible or PagerDuty. These actions can be linked with Instana events and will then be visible to each event instance as a potential action to run. The Action Catalog lets you run actions manually or automatically and can leverage artificial intelligence (AI) to get recommended actions to run based on event context. 

Instana’s sensors automatically collect changes, metrics and events. Instana delivers high-fidelity data in monitoring, with unmatched granularity (one-second) and high cardinality—capturing an end-to-end trace of each and every request. When it comes to proactive, automated health monitoring, each sensor has an out-of-the-box curated knowledge base of health signatures that are evaluated continuously against the incoming metrics and are used to raise issues or incidents depending on user impact. A component’s health is determined by applying machine learning and preset health rules.

Instana’s automatic, full-stack visibility spans across the entire monitoring lifecycle. From the single, self-monitoring and auto-updating agent to the automatic and continuous discovery, deployment, configuration and dependency mapping, Instana fills the gaps that many APM tools, like New Relic, don’t. With zero-configuration dashboards, alerting, troubleshooting and remediation, Instana relieves teams from manual and time-consuming processes.

Learn more about the differences between Instana and New Relic
Was this article helpful?
YesNo

More from Automation

Achieving cloud excellence and efficiency with cloud maturity models

6 min read - Business leaders worldwide are asking their teams the same question: “Are we using the cloud effectively?” This quandary often comes with an accompanying worry: “Are we spending too much money on cloud computing?” Given the statistics—82% of surveyed respondents in a 2023 Statista study cited managing cloud spend as a significant challenge—it’s a legitimate concern. Concerns around security, governance and lack of resources and expertise also top the list of respondents’ concerns. Cloud maturity models are a useful tool for…

Using full stack automation to drive app-centric networking with IBM Rapid Network Automation

3 min read - Today, we’re announcing the general availability of IBM® Rapid Network Automation—the first solution that stems from our Pliant acquisition in March. IBM Rapid Network Automation is an advanced API-driven tool that is designed to automate, integrate and connect infrastructure across a hybrid cloud environment. Using a low-code approach and transforming API code into deployment-ready action blocks, IBM Rapid Network Automation is equipped with thousands of out-of-the-box integrations that help facilitate, integrate and secure communication up and down the technology stack…

Generate Ansible Playbooks faster by using watsonx Code Assistant for Red Hat Ansible Lightspeed

2 min read - IBM watsonx™ Code Assistant is a suite of products designed to support AI-assisted code development and application modernization. Within this suite, IBM watsonx Code Assistant for Red Hat® Ansible® Lightspeed equips developers with generative AI (gen AI) capabilities, accelerating the creation of Ansible Playbooks. In early 2024, IBM watsonx Code Assistant for Red Hat Ansible Lightspeed introduced model customization and a no-cost 30-day trial. Building on this momentum, we are excited to announce the on-premises release of watsonx Code Assistant for Red Hat Ansible Lightspeed,…

IBM Newsletters

Get our newsletters and topic updates that deliver the latest thought leadership and insights on emerging trends.
Subscribe now More newsletters